konfigurasi Radio server (ICECAST2) on debian server

Assalamualaikum wr.wb



1.Pendahuluan

a.Pengertian

   ICECAST2 adalah Server Media streaming yang saat ini mendukung Ogg (Vorbis dan Theora), Opus, WebM dan MP3 audio stream. Hal ini dapat digunakan untuk membuat stasiun radio internet atau lukebox berjalan pribadi dan banyak hal di antaranya, Hal ini sangat sebaguna dalam bahwa format baru dapat ditambahkan relatif mudah dan mendukung standart terbuka untuk komunikasi dan internet

b..latar belakang
    Menambahkan fitur di dalam Server kita agar dapat melengkapi kebutuhan kita , namu kali ini saya membuat Radio Server ini masih dalam sekala local karena masih menggunakan jaringan local saya untuk kedepan nya semoga dapat digunakan untuk semua jaringan publik

c.maksud dan tujuan

membangun Radio Server ini adalah Membuat suatu stasiun radio yang dimana fungsinya sebagai sarana hiburan dan lain sebagainya

d.alat dan bahan

server
laptop
akses internet


e.jangka waktu
5-10 menit

f.tahap pelaksanaan
1.Pertama kita install Icecastnya terlebih dahulu dengan cara
#apt-get install icecast2


  maka akan muncul seperti ini , kita lanjut dengan pilih yes => enter


masukan hostname dengan domain yang sudah kalian buat


Kemudian setelah anda mengisi hostname maka anda disuruh untuk memasukkan password untuk user source-nya , yaitu user penyiarnya seperti gambar di bawah ini


setelah password source nya kemudian anda diminta memasukkan lagi password untuk user relay seperti gambar di bawah ini, masukkan passwordnya kemudian tekan tab lalu pilih OK kemudian enter


setelah password relay tadi kemudian diminta lagi untuk mengisikan password untuk administration yaitu password log in admin melalui web, setelah itu kita tab pilih ok lalu kita enter 


Kemudian kita tunggu sampai konfigurasinya selesai, setelah selesai kita lakukan konfigurasi radio nya , konfigurasi ini ada 2 file yang harus di konfigurasi  yaitu:

"/etc/icecast2/icecast.xml" dan "/etc/default/icecast2" 

2.selanjutnya kita terebih dahulu editfil pertama , ikuti perintah perintah di bawah ini

#nano /etc/icecast2/icecast.xml



kemudian silahkan cari bagian authentication dengan mengunakan kata hackme , caranya tekan ctrl+w kemudian masukkan kata hackme,
Setelah keluar silahkan ubah bagian hackme dengan password yang sesuai dengan anda masukkan saat installasi icecast2 seperti gambar berikut


ubah nama password hackme dengan paswword sudah kalian buat tadi


Setelah itu kita simpan dan keluar dengan menekan ctrl+x kemudian Y lalu kita enter, 

3.selanjutnyan kita edit file .etc/default/icecast3 dengan mengetikkan perintah sebagai berikut ini

#nano /etc/dafault/icecast2


Pada bagian terbawah terdapat kata "ENABLE=false" klemudian kita ubah kata "false" tadi dengan kata "true" kemudian kita simpan dan keluar dengan menekan ctrl+x kemudian y lalu kita enter, seperti gambar di atas


4.Kemudian setelah itu kita service icecast2 dengan perintah  
#/etc/init.d/icecast2 restart
#/etc/init.d/icecast start
#/etc/init.d/icecast reload



Kemudian tahap selanjutnya radio icecast2 dapat anda buka di port "8000" cara nya ketikkan kata berikut di URL browser "http://ipserver:8000 atau domain:8000 seperti gambar di bawah ini


    Anda dapat login sebagai admin dengan username admin dan password anda tadi, lalu bagai mana anda dapat on air atau siaran radio????? , 
Jawaban nya anda dapat siaran radio dengan aplikasi mixxx untuk OS Linux mixx untuk Windows , dan aplikasi idjc untuk Linux Maupun Windows , trus timbul pertanyaan mungkin , bagaimana untyuk cara menginstallnya di Linux (ubuntu) ??? Ketika anda pengen menginstallnya di Linux caranya sangat sangatlah mudah tinggal mengetikkan perintah sebagai berikut (#apt -get install mixxx ) pada laptop Client bersistem Linux atau untuk windows silahkan Download mixx (https://www.mixxx.org/ ) dan silahkan di install


5.Pertama kita buka aplikasi mixxx yang terinstall di pc penyiar radionya, kemudian kita klik menu option > Preferances > Live broadcasting, seperti gambar berikut ini



6.Setelah itu kita isikan bagian bagian untuk pengaturan Live broadcasting, anda harus  mengisi bagian berikut

Type    : type dari server radio broadcast yang digunakan misal icecast1, icecast2, southcast
Log in  : Tempat untuk mengisi username yaitu icecast2 usernamenya "source
Mount  : Bagian yang di akses client untuk mendengarkan radio 
Port     : yaitu diisi port dari sistem icecast2
Password : pasword login dari user source 

Anda juga harus memberitanda centang pada bagian Enable live broadcasting kemidian klik OK  muncul seperti gambar di bawah


Setelah itu kita putarkan lagu yang akan di dengarkan oleh Clien, 

                                                   


lalu buka melalui browser clien dengan mengetikan http://ipserver:8000 => http://192.168.40:8000 atau bengbeng.com 



Maka untuk mendengarkan si penyiar anda dapat mengklik bagian radio seperti gambar di atas dan kemudian akian muncul seperti gambar di atas





Hasil dan Kesimpulan 

Hasil nya saya dapat melakukan konfigurasi dari awal penginstallan hingga pengkonfigurasian icecast2 dengan lsncsr , namun ada sedikit kebdala dari pengkonfigurasian saya , karena kirangnya ketelitian saat pengkonfigurasiian , dan kemudian radio yang saya buat ini dapat digunaan dengan baik

Referensi
 http://192.168.153.3/data/eBook%20TKJ/Buku%20Konfigurasi%20Debian%20Server_Ver_BLC-Telkom.pdf

Tidak ada komentar:

Posting Komentar